I purchased 9 light Sussex hens which are now 23 weeks old, 3 of these have fully developed combes but i am only getting 1 egg every 3-4 days from the 9.
I am feeding them on a mixture of layers pellets & wheat, whats gone wrong, the chicken run measures 30 meters by 13 meters so not short of space.
when purchased i was informed that they were POL so what is going wrong ???
If anyone has any advice it would be extremely helpful if you could post me some advice on this matter,

Many Thanks from a troubled Chicken owner . :)
 
Sussex in general are slow to mature in my opinion. My Coronations did not seem to start laying on a regular basis until about week 25 to 30. With that said when they do start they are egg laying machines. I have also noticed that my Sussex tend to drop off some when the temp is in the 90's more so than my other breeds.
